Healthy Lunchbox Week

Anson Street School has taken part in Healthy Lunchbox Week this week. Healthy Lunchbox Week is a Nutrition Australia initiative that helps families access lunchbox information and recipes setting them up for the year ahead.

 

Around one-third of children’s daily food intake comes from the lunchbox so it’s important we make it count. Kids are much more willing to explore new foods when they have helped to prepare or to cook it. So get them involved in making their lunches, trying new lunch recipes or sandwich ideas.

 

If your child has a limited range of accepted foods, this is a great activity to get them more comfortable around new and unfamiliar foods.
